Composable Commerce Cost: How to Optimize Implementation

Photo of Robert Scholz

Robert Scholz

Feb 18, 2025 • 15 min read

Composable commerce has captured the interest of e-commerce leaders due to its promise of agility, rapid innovation, and highly customizable user experiences.

However, adopting a composable commerce solution can be expensive if not approached with careful planning—especially in the early stages. At Netguru, we’ve guided brands through successful composable commerce projects, helping them strike the balance between robust functionality and prudent budgeting. This article explores proven strategies for keeping implementation costs under control while still reaping the long-term benefits of a composable ecosystem.

1. Benefits of Composable Commerce

Composable commerce offers several benefits, including:

  • Faster Innovation: Composable commerce allows businesses to pilot or roll out new features in one service without waiting to upgrade or re-architect an entire system. This agility enables rapid response to market changes and customer demands.

  • Personalization on a Deeper Level: By picking and choosing specialized components—like advanced product recommendation engines or dynamic pricing modules—businesses can create truly unique customer experiences that drive engagement and loyalty.

  • High Resilience: If one microservice encounters a glitch, other parts of the store remain unaffected, ensuring continuous operation and a seamless customer experience.

  • Omnichannel Integration: Composable commerce enables seamless integration with various sales channels (physical stores, mobile apps, marketplaces), ensuring a consistent brand experience wherever customers shop.

  • Lower Total Cost of Ownership: By investing specifically in areas of their business that need the most attention, businesses can keep costs in check and avoid the expenses associated with monolithic platforms.

2. Embrace Gradual, Phased Adoption of Composable Commerce Strategy

A common mistake is to tear down your existing e-commerce infrastructure all at once and rebuild it as a fully composable platform. While that might be necessary in some edge cases, it often leads to high upfront expenses and potential disruption.

  • Cost-Optimization Tip: Instead of a full-scale overhaul, start small by replacing just one component—like the frontend or the checkout module—with a composable alternative. Iterate gradually, swapping out legacy parts in targeted phases. This approach spares you from having to manage a massive, costly replatforming project all at once, allowing you to transition smoothly to more flexible and efficient digital commerce platforms.

3. Leverage Existing Assets

Switching to composable commerce doesn’t necessarily mean discarding every system you own. If your existing backend or payment gateway works well, consider keeping it in place while you modernize the user-facing experience or add microservices to handle new functions.

  • Cost-Optimization Tip: Perform an inventory of current tools and services to identify which still meet your performance, security, and scalability needs. By building around effective systems, you reduce the scope—and cost—of changes.

Benefits of Composable Commerce

  • Core Commerce Functionality: Composable commerce ensures that essential capabilities required for effective online selling are integrated seamlessly, allowing businesses to address unique needs while remaining adaptable to change.

4. Select Vendors and Partners Wisely

When building a composable architecture, you’ll probably work with multiple vendors (e.g., a PIM solution, an AI-based recommendation engine, a cloud platform). Not all providers offer the same level of integration, scalability, or pricing models. These microservices, often referred to as packaged business capabilities (PBCs), facilitate a plug-and-play functionality, allowing businesses to select and integrate only the components they need.

  • Cost-Optimization Tip: Conduct a rigorous vendor evaluation, focusing on value for money rather than sheer feature lists. Ask about hidden fees, support tiers, and ongoing maintenance costs. Look for vendors that align with your existing ecosystem or have proven integrations with your chosen microservices. Netguru often assists clients by mapping out the vendor landscape to ensure every piece fits seamlessly and cost-effectively.

5. Budget Planning and Alignment

A frequent source of budget overruns stems from underestimating either the complexity of integration or the time needed for testing. As composable commerce systems expand, scope creep becomes a real risk if you lack clear milestones and a well-defined budget.

  • Cost-Optimization Tip: Create a detailed project plan that outlines each microservice deployment, integration point, and testing phase. Factor in contingencies for unexpected challenges, especially around legacy data migration or custom API work. Keep stakeholders informed about budget usage and progress.

6. Invest in Team Training vs. Hiring

Recruiting a brand-new team of composable commerce experts can be costly, especially given today’s competitive talent market. Instead, consider upskilling your existing developers and IT staff.

  • Cost-Optimization Tip: Workshops, on-the-job training, and mentorship can help your current workforce adapt to headless architectures, microservices, and modern frontend frameworks. This approach avoids hefty recruitment costs and strengthens internal knowledge for future expansions.

7. Use Existing Libraries and FaaS Solutions for Seamless Integration

One reason composable commerce can inflate costs is the time spent creating custom frontends from scratch. While a fully bespoke user interface has its advantages, you can often speed up development and lower expenses by leveraging pre-built libraries or Frontend as a Service (FaaS) solutions.

  • Cost-Optimization Tip: Many platforms provide templated frontends that can be customized to match your brand identity. By starting with established building blocks, you reduce time-to-market and minimize the risk of code duplication or QA overhead.

8. Adopt an Iterative Methodology

A waterfall-style approach—where you plan the entire transition in one monolithic project—makes it harder to pivot if costs become too steep.

  • Cost-Optimization Tip: Break your composable commerce rollout into small, iterative sprints. You can pilot an integration or a new microservice with a limited user group, gather feedback, then refine before scaling it up. Iterative development fosters continuous improvement and helps you catch budget overruns early.

9. Avoid Overengineering

The allure of composable commerce can inspire teams to add multiple microservices, each performing a highly specialized function. While that granularity can be powerful, it can also lead to complexity.

  • Cost-Optimization Tip: Evaluate each microservice rigorously. Is there a business need for a standalone service, or could you combine functionalities without losing agility? Striking the right balance between microservices and overarching orchestration is crucial to managing costs.

10. Eliminate Unnecessary Features

Because composable commerce allows you to pick and choose modules, you might be tempted to adopt every cutting-edge tool on the market. But every additional feature raises license fees, integration time, and support overhead.

  • Cost-Optimization Tip: Determine which functionalities truly deliver ROI. For instance, if your user base doesn’t typically engage with augmented reality (AR) or voice assistants, you may not need to deploy those services immediately. Focus on the microservices that align with your core objectives.

11. Keep Monitoring and Analyzing

The composable approach isn’t just a one-off implementation—it’s a living ecosystem that will evolve over time. Costs can creep up as you add more services or expand your user base.

  • Cost-Optimization Tip: Use real-time monitoring tools to track resource utilization, performance metrics, and user engagement. If you notice a particular microservice underperforming or over-consuming resources, you can adjust or replace it. At Netguru, we stress the importance of continuous analysis to keep budgets in check.

12. Leverage Cloud and SaaS Options

Deploying microservices on-premises can incur high hardware and maintenance expenses. Many composable commerce components are available as cloud-based or SaaS solutions.

  • Cost-Optimization Tip: By opting for cloud hosting—AWS, Azure, Google Cloud, or specialized SaaS providers—you often gain scalability and pay-as-you-go billing models. This approach limits upfront costs and makes it easier to handle traffic surges without costly overprovisioning.

13. Explore Hybrid Models if Needed

Not every business can move fully into composable commerce. Some smaller companies may find standard SaaS solutions (like Shopify or BigCommerce) more cost-effective. If your operations require more customization, a hybrid approach might be ideal—where part of your stack is composable and part relies on a managed service.

  • Cost-Optimization Tip: Align your decisions with your long-term strategy. A hybrid environment can offer the best of both worlds—cost savings from a managed service in certain areas, plus the agility of microservices where it truly matters.

14. Plan for Long-Term ROI and Total Cost of Ownership

Yes, composable commerce can appear more expensive during the initial phases of adoption. However, over time, the ability to evolve quickly, reduce technical debt, and avoid paying for one-size-fits-all monolithic features can lead to real savings.

  • Cost-Optimization Tip: Approach your cost analysis from a multi-year perspective. Factor in how quickly you can deploy new features (and capitalize on new revenue streams) and how seamlessly you can replace outdated modules without a large-scale rebuild.

15. Seek Expert Guidance

Managing the intricacies of composable commerce—from technology selection to integration workflows—can be daunting. Engaging an experienced partner like Netguru can mitigate costly mistakes, accelerate development, and ensure your architecture is both high-performing and financially sustainable.

  • Cost-Optimization Tip: Conduct a thorough consultation early in the project. External experts can help you set realistic timelines, budget forecasts, and best practices for implementation.

16. Measuring Success

Measuring the success of a composable commerce strategy requires a combination of metrics and KPIs. Some key metrics to track include:

  • Customer Satisfaction: Measure customer satisfaction through surveys, feedback forms, and social media monitoring to gauge how well the composable commerce platform meets customer needs.

  • Conversion Rates: Track conversion rates to see how effectively the composable commerce platform is driving sales and achieving business goals.

  • Average Order Value: Monitor average order value to assess whether the composable commerce platform is contributing to revenue growth.

  • Return on Investment (ROI): Calculate the ROI of the composable commerce platform to determine if it is delivering a positive financial return.

  • Time-to-Market: Measure the time it takes to launch new features and products to evaluate if the composable commerce platform is improving business agility and responsiveness.

17. Overcoming Common Challenges

Composable commerce can present several challenges, including managing multiple vendors and technologies, integrating various components and services, and investing in robust infrastructure and monitoring tools. To overcome these challenges, businesses can:

  • Develop a Clear Composable Commerce Strategy: Align the composable commerce strategy with business goals to ensure a focused and effective implementation.

  • Invest in Robust Infrastructure and Monitoring Tools: Ensure the composable commerce platform is supported by a strong infrastructure and comprehensive monitoring tools to maintain performance and reliability.

  • Develop a Skilled IT Team: Build a team capable of managing and integrating multiple vendors and technologies, ensuring seamless operation and innovation.

  • Implement a Phased Migration Approach: Minimize disruption by gradually transitioning to a composable commerce system, allowing for continuous operation and iterative improvements.

  • Continuously Monitor and Evaluate Performance: Regularly assess the performance of the composable commerce platform to identify areas for improvement and ensure it continues to meet business needs.

By addressing these challenges proactively, businesses can fully leverage the benefits of composable commerce and create a resilient, flexible, and cost-effective digital commerce ecosystem.

18. Review and Reassess Periodically

Composable commerce isn’t a “set-and-forget” solution. Regularly evaluate your environment. Are you retaining microservices that are no longer beneficial? Could consolidation reduce overhead? By staying proactive, you’ll keep your platform lean and cost-effective.

  • Cost-Optimization Tip: Conduct quarterly or biannual reviews, analyzing usage statistics, feature effectiveness, and any changing market conditions. This helps you retire redundant components and explore new ones that offer better value.

How Netguru Can Help

At Netguru, we’ve guided numerous brands through successful composable commerce projects, helping them optimize costs without sacrificing functionality. Our team of experts can assist in:

  • Assessing your current e-commerce setup and identifying areas where a composable approach can bring the most value.

  • Developing a clear strategy for phased adoption, leveraging existing assets, and selecting the right vendors and partners.

  • Providing training and mentorship to upskill your internal team in composable commerce best practices and technologies.

  • Implementing and integrating the selected microservices, ensuring seamless communication and optimal performance.

  • Providing ongoing support and guidance as your composable commerce ecosystem evolves and new opportunities for optimization emerge.

Conclusion

While composable commerce does require thoughtful investment upfront, the approach can ultimately yield cost efficiencies and improved business agility. By phasing your implementation, leveraging existing assets, choosing vendors wisely, and continuously monitoring performance, you can strike a careful balance between robust functionality and manageable spending.

Through a combination of smart planning, iterative development, and rigorous vendor evaluation, you can pave the way for a future-proof e-commerce ecosystem that fuels sustainable growth. If you’re considering a composable commerce implementation and looking to optimize costs, Netguru is here to help you navigate every step of the process.

Photo of Robert Scholz

More posts by this author

Robert Scholz

Transform with bespoke software

Create solutions that grow with you

Get started!

Read more on our Blog

Check out the knowledge base collected and distilled by experienced professionals.

We're Netguru

At Netguru we specialize in designing, building, shipping and scaling beautiful, usable products with blazing-fast efficiency.

Let's talk business